#7CA500 Hex color

#7CA500

The hexadecimal color code #7CA500 corresponds to the code RGB( 124, 165, 0 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,49 level), green (at 0,65 level) and blue (at 0,00 level). Its brightness is 32% and its saturation is 100%. It is composed of red at 42%, green at 57% and blue at 0%.
